“Come, buy . . . without money and without cost.”
Isaiah 55:1
Imagine walking into a gourmet grocery store and lingering over the dark chocolate delicacies, the exotic fruit, and the imported cheese. As you look around, a clerk comes up to you and hands you a card. It reads: “Fill your cart for free today.” What joy you’d have walking the aisles, finding special treats, and putting them into your cart.
Now, wouldn’t you be grateful and excited about this amazing opportunity? You would probably tell everyone you know!
Think for a minute about the salvation Jesus offers. He gave himself freely in death on the cross so we could freely receive such priceless gifts as love, hope, and eternal life. Aren’t you grateful and excited about this amazing opportunity? Doesn’t it make sense to tell everyone you know! Think about those people in your life who would benefit from hearing about this generous God. Spend some time praying for each one, asking God to give you excited words about his free salvation.
Lord, thank you for your gift of salvation: while it is free to me, I know it cost you everything. May I live a life of gratitude, amen.
